Paul George Suffered No Structural Damage To Knee, Out At Least Next Two Games

Paul George will miss at least the next two games for the Philadelphia 76ers after hyperextending his left knee in Wednesday’s loss against the Memphis Grizzlies. George previously hyperextended the knee during the preseason.

George will be reevaluated on Monday and will miss upcoming games against the Brooklyn Nets and Los Angeles Clippers.

George’s MRI showed no structural damage.
